Get started2 Radlett Park Road is a semi-detached house in Radlett (WD7 7BQ). It has a recorded floor area of 206 m² (around 2217 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(December 2014)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from December 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It hasn't traded since June 1997, a hold of 29 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£1,134,000 sits 316.1% above the 1997 sale of £272,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£123/sq ft) was about 69.9% below the postcode norm.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 206 m² it's 17.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(175 m² median across 7 EPCs).
